About Gilla
Gilla is a small rural locality in South East Queensland, situated approximately 90 kilometres north-west of Brisbane in the Somerset region near Toogoolawah. The locality covers around 89 square kilometres of hinterland farming and bushland country. With a 2021 Census population of approximately 61 residents, Gilla is a very lightly settled agricultural area in the Esk district of the upper Brisbane River valley.
Toogoolawah, approximately 10 kilometres to the east, and the larger town of Esk, roughly 20 kilometres away, provide general services for the district including shops, schools, and medical facilities. The area is known for its scenic hinterland landscape, proximity to Lake Somerset, and the Somerset Dam recreational area. A private vehicle is essential as no public transport serves this locality.
